From Morse Code to AI Chatbots: The Future of Human–Message Interaction

Every generation invents new ways to speak to the world, but only a few inventions completely reshape how humanity connects. Long before smartphones, apps, or the internet, communication depended on paper, travel, and patience. Messages crossed oceans by ship and borders by rail, often arriving weeks after they were written. Then, in 1844, Samuel Morse sent his now-famous message — “What hath God wrought?” — and something extraordinary happened.

EU Funding
Project title: Open-Source SMS Gateway
Description: Development of an SMS Gateway, a telecommunications software that allows the mass sending and receiving of text messages (SMS).
Budget: 472.031,98 € - EU Funding: 236.327,44 €
